![]() Click thumbnail for a larger image. | Description: The pea crops were mown with a grass mower and this machine collected up the peas vines which were loaded onto a truck and taken to the pea viner stations where the peas were threshed. The waste was made into silage for stock feed. In Circular Head the viner stations were at Rocky Cape, Irishtown, Forest and Nabageena.
